| Display | 1.8-inch LED with large red digits, 12-hour format (AM/PM), manual or auto-dimming brightness |
| Power Source | 4 AA alkaline batteries (up to 12 months) or USB-C cable (adapter not included) |
| Alarm Volume Levels | 3 adjustable volume settings |
| Snooze Duration | 10 minutes per tap |
| Size | 5.5 inches (W) x 2.5 inches (H) |
| Additional Features | Manual DST adjustment, auto-dimming sensor, easy-to-use labeled buttons |

| Display | Large 2-inch high digits with 3 adjustable brightness settings and optional off mode |
| Power Source | 4 AA batteries (not included), alkaline recommended |
| Alarm Volume | Adjustable with 5 volume settings, super loud for heavy sleepers |
| Auto Dimming | Automatic brightness adjustment based on ambient light |
| Time Format | 12-hour or 24-hour (military) display with manual DST on/off |
| Additional Features | Touch-sensitive snooze button (9-minute nap), manual brightness control, battery indicator |

Why is Alarm Functionality Crucial for Daily Use?
Alarm functionality is crucial for daily use because it helps individuals manage their time effectively. Alarms serve as reminders for important tasks, appointments, or transitions throughout the day, ensuring people stay organized and punctual.
The National Sleep Foundation defines an alarm clock as a device that helps people wake up at a designated time. It typically uses sound, light, or vibration to alert users. Alarms can play a significant role in promoting better time management and personal productivity.
Several reasons underline the importance of alarm functionality. First, alarms help establish a routine. They signal the start and end of activities, reinforcing time management skills. Second, alarms can enhance accountability. For example, setting an alarm for a meeting encourages individuals to prepare and arrive on time. Lastly, alarms assist in improving sleep hygiene by helping regulate sleep schedules.
Technical terms related to alarm functionality include “circadian rhythm,” which is the body’s natural sleep-wake cycle. A well-functioning alarm can aid in maintaining a consistent circadian rhythm by promoting regular wake-up times. Disruptions in this rhythm can lead to issues such as sleep disorders or decreased productivity.
Alarm mechanisms involve acoustic signals, visual displays, or tactile feedback. Acoustic signals are typically sounds produced by the device to wake the user. Visual displays may use light, such as a sunrise alarm clock that gradually brightens to simulate natural light. Tactile feedback involves vibration, often used in wearable devices for discreet alerts.
